How do I edit, delete, and copy forecast entries?

In LivePlan, each forecast item can be modified as needed. This means you can easily update any of the data, delete entries that are no longer relevant, or make a copy of an existing entry to use as a template for new projections. 

Editing a forecast entry

If you want to edit an item you have already entered in the forecast (for example, a revenue stream, expense, asset, etc.), first navigate to the desired page of the Forecast section.

Look for the table of your entries near the bottom of the page, then click on the green title of the item you'd like to update:

Clicking any green title will open the editing options for that item.

For most entries, you'll have a series of overlays to navigate through in order to access the original numbers. Use the Next and Back buttons to navigate between them or click on the section numbers, as shown below:

You can edit any part of your entry. Click Save & Exit when you're done. To discard changes, click on the X in the upper-right corner of the editor window:

Click Discard to return to the Forecast or Cancel to continue editing the entry:

Note: In certain tables, such as the Personnel table, you may need to click the triangle icons to expand the lines so you can access the editable entries, as shown below:

Deleting a forecast entry

To delete a forecast item you've already entered, click on the three dots that appear when you mouse over a forecast entry:

Select Delete from the drop-down menu:

Click Delete to confirm or Cancel to go back without deleting the forecast item:

You can make a copy of any forecast item that you've already created. LivePlan will take all settings and figures entered in the original item and apply them to the new forecast item.

Note: Forecast items can only be copied from the same category as the original. For example, copies of a revenue item will always be copied to the revenue section of the forecast.

To copy an item in the forecast

  1. Click on the Forecast section and choose one of the forecast categories:

  2. Mouse over the forecast item that you wish to copy and click on the three dots :

  3. Select Duplicate:

  4. In the dialog that appears, give the copy a new name and click Make a Copy:

When you’re finished, click Make a Copy. The copy will appear as an item in your currently selected forecast category.

NOTE: Copied forecast items will retain all settings and forecast figures of the original.
